When I had reset my avatar during a frustration of adding avatars, I wasn't exactly planning to see the default avatar go back. I figured it was no big deal and I'll add an avatar again. Problem is, that default avatar haunts all my past works that I haven't created afterwards/edited. Wondering if this has happened to anyone else and there's an easy fix to this? That's an interesting issue... It seems that the origin of the issue is due to the fact that older posts memorize the file extension of your avatar, and try to use it again.
Basically : the older post try to load an image named "emilytheblonde.gif". it doesn't exist anymore, since it is now "emilytheblonde.png", and thus, display the "default avatar".
Now that you used a few time your new .png avatar, I guess that if you reverted back to a new .gif avatar, the old posts would have a correct avatar, and the new ones not.
